How Our Bathtub Overflow Water Removal Service Works

We understand that every situation is unique, which is why we tailor our approach to your specific needs. Here’s a step-by-step overview of our process:

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our technicians will quickly assess the situation, identify the source of the leak, and contain the affected area to prevent further spreading. They’ll use specialized equipment to ensure the water is safely contained.

Step 2: Water Removal

Next, our team will extract the water using powerful pumps and vacuums, carefully removing as much water as possible to prevent further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use advanced moisture detection equipment to identify areas of high moisture and apply specialized drying and dehumidification techniques to ensure your home is completely dry.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once your home is dry, our technicians will thoroughly clean and sanitize all affected areas to prevent mold growth and bacterial contamination.

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ction

Finally, we’ll work with you to restore your home to its original state, including any necessary repairs or reconstruction to ensure your safety and satisfaction.

Bathtub Overflow Water Removal Cost in Parma Heights, OH

The cost of bathtub overflow water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Parma Heights, OH. Here are some estimated price ranges for common scenarios: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Small leak cleanup (less than 1 gallon) $200 – $500 Size of affected area, type of flooring
Medium-sized leak cleanup (1-5 gallons) $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of flooring, number of rooms affected
Large leak cleanup (5-10 gallons) $2,500 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, number of rooms affected, structural damage
Black mold remediation $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, type of mold growth
Water damage behind walls or ceilings $1,500 – $4,000 Size of affected area, type of damage, structural issues
Emergency response and cleanup (after hours) $500 – $2,000 Time of day, severity of damage, location

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ost of bathtub overflow water removal will depend on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ide a free on-site assessment to find out the best course of action and provide a customized quote.

Common Questions About Bathtub Overflow Water Removal

How long will it take to complete the cleanup?

Our team will work efficiently to complete the cleanup as quickly as possible, typically within 24-48 hours, depending on the severity of the damage.

Will I need to replace my flooring?

It depends on the extent of the damage. If the flooring has been severely damaged, it may need to be replaced. But, our team will assess the damage and provide a recommendation for the best course of action.

Can I use bleach to clean up the water damage?

No, bleach is not recommended for cleaning up water damage. It can actually cause more harm than good, damaging surfaces and potentially leading to further health issues. Our team will use spec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to ensure a safe and effective cleanup.

How do I prevent future bathtub overflows?

To prevent future bathtub overflows, ensure your bathtub drain is regularly cleaned and maintained. You can also consider installing a drain screen or filter to catch hair and other debris that can cause clogs.
